What is the difference between Remote Cfo Consulting vs Bookkeeper?
| Aspect | Remote Cfo Consulting | Bookkeeper |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Financial expertise, CPA or CPA-equivalent, strategic finance background | Basic accounting knowledge, often no formal certification required |
| Work Environment | Consulting, remote or client-site, strategic planning focus | Office or remote, transactional data entry and record keeping |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Businesses seeking financial strategy, startups, SMBs | Small businesses, retail, service industries |
Remote Cfo Consulting involves strategic financial management, planning, and high-level decision-making, often requiring advanced credentials. Bookkeepers handle day-to-day transaction recording and basic financial data. While both roles support business finances, Remote Cfo Consulting focuses on strategic oversight, whereas bookkeepers focus on record-keeping.

The Director of Financial Planning & Analysis (FP&A) leads the Company’s budgeting, forecasting, pricing, financial modeling, profitability analysis, and operational financial analysis function. This role serves as a key financial partner to the President & CFO and business leadership, translating operational assumptions and financial data into actionable analysis that supports pricing decisions, resource allocation, contract performance, growth opportunities, and long-term planning. The Director of FP&A has primary responsibility for the annual budget and forecasting processes and leads financial pricing and modeling for new and existing business opportunities. The role works closely with the Director of Accounting/Controller, while maintaining a distinct forward-looking focus on planning, pricing, performance analysis, and decision support.
Budgeting & Financial Planning
- Lead the Company’s annual budgeting process across departments, contracts, locations, and lines of business.
- Partner with operations and department leaders to build budgets based on revenue, staffing, productivity, compensation, operating expenses, and other business drivers.
- Develop and maintain consolidated Company budgets and detailed budgets by contract, department, location, and line of business.
- Maintain rolling forecasts and update financial expectations based on actual performance and changing business conditions.
- Develop long-range financial plans, headcount plans, labor models, and capital expenditure analyses.
Pricing & New Business Analysis
- Lead financial modeling and pricing for new business opportunities, contract renewals, expansions, modifications, and other significant opportunities.
- Develop detailed pricing models incorporating labor, benefits, payroll taxes, overhead, technology, facilities, subcontractors, capital requirements, and other direct and indirect costs.
- Work with Operations and business leaders to develop appropriate staffing, productivity, utilization, training, ramp-up, and performance assumptions.
- Analyze proposed pricing for expected contribution margin, operating margin, break-even points, and return to investment.
- Perform sensitivity and scenario analysis for changes in staffing, wages, productivity, volume, pricing, contract terms, and other assumptions.
- Support pricing for government contracts, commercial contracts, BPO opportunities, and other Company lines of business.
- Compare actual contract performance with original pricing assumptions and use findings to improve future pricing models.
Forecasting & Financial Performance
- Prepare monthly, quarterly, and annual financial forecasts.
- Analyze actual results against budget, forecast, prior periods, and original pricing assumptions.
- Identify and explain significant revenue, labor, operating expense, and margin variances.
- Develop forecast for revenue, labor, headcount, operating expenses, contribution margin, and operating income.
- Identify emerging financial risks and opportunities and communicate them to the President & CFO and appropriate business leaders.
Contract & Business Unit Profitability
- Develop and maintain profitability reporting by contract, client, location, and line of business.
- Analyze contract-level revenue, direct labor, benefits, operating costs, allocated overhead, contribution margin, and profitability.
- Partner with Operations to understand the operational drivers behind financial performance.
- Identify underperforming contracts or business units and help leadership understand root causes and potential corrective actions.
- Evaluate the financial impact of staffing changes, wage adjustments, incentive programs, remote/hybrid work arrangements, facility utilization, and other operational decisions.
- Develop appropriate cost allocation methodologies in coordination with the President and CFO and Director of Accounting/Controller.
Executive Decision Support
- Serve as financial business partner to the President & CFO and executive leadership.
- Translate financial and operations data into clear, actionable recommendations.
- Prepare financial analysis supporting major operations and strategic decisions.
- Evaluate potential investments, acquisitions, new locations, contract opportunities, facility decisions, and other strategic initiatives.
- Develop scenario models and executive-level financial presentations for senior leadership and ownership as requested.
- Provide independent financial challenge to operational assumptions when appropriate.
Management Reporting & Process Improvement
- Work closely with the Director of Accounting/Controller following monthly close to analyzing actual financial results.
- Prepare management reporting packages including budget-to-actual results, forecasts, KPIs, trends, and variance explanations.
- Develop dashboards and reporting tools that improve visibility in business performance.
- Connect operational metrics such as staffing, hours worked, productivity, utilization, collections, call volumes, and other performance measures to financial results.
- Develop and maintain standardized models for budgeting, forecasting, pricing, and profitability analysis.
- Identify opportunities to automate and improve the accuracy, efficiency, and consistency of financial planning and analysis.
